Buying Guide for the Best Hose Crimping Tools

When it comes to choosing hose crimping tools, it's important to understand that these tools are essential for creating secure and reliable connections in hoses. Whether you're working with hydraulic hoses, air hoses, or other types of hoses, the right crimping tool can make a significant difference in the quality and durability of your connections. To make an informed decision, you need to consider several key specifications that will help you find the best fit for your needs.
Crimping CapacityCrimping capacity refers to the range of hose sizes that the tool can handle. This is important because you need a tool that can accommodate the specific sizes of hoses you work with. Crimping capacities are usually measured in inches or millimeters. If you work with a variety of hose sizes, look for a tool with a wide crimping capacity range. For specialized tasks, a tool with a more narrow, specific range might be more suitable. Consider the hoses you most frequently use and ensure the tool can handle those sizes.
Die CompatibilityDies are the interchangeable parts of the crimping tool that actually make the crimp. Die compatibility is crucial because it determines the types of crimps you can make. Some tools come with a set of dies, while others require you to purchase them separately. It's important to ensure that the dies you need are available and compatible with the tool you choose. If you need to make different types of crimps, look for a tool that offers a wide range of compatible dies. For more specialized work, ensure the tool supports the specific dies you need.
Power SourceHose crimping tools can be manual, electric, or hydraulic. The power source affects the ease of use and the types of jobs the tool can handle. Manual crimping tools are portable and don't require a power source, making them ideal for on-site work or occasional use. Electric crimping tools offer more power and are suitable for frequent use or larger jobs. Hydraulic crimping tools provide the most power and are best for heavy-duty applications. Consider where and how often you'll be using the tool to determine the best power source for your needs.
PortabilityPortability refers to how easy it is to transport and use the crimping tool in different locations. This is important if you need to move the tool between job sites or use it in tight spaces. Portable crimping tools are typically lighter and more compact, making them easier to carry and maneuver. However, they may have lower crimping capacities or fewer features compared to larger, stationary models. If you need a tool for on-the-go use, prioritize portability. For workshop or stationary use, a larger, more feature-rich tool might be more appropriate.
Ease of UseEase of use encompasses how user-friendly the crimping tool is, including factors like setup, operation, and maintenance. A tool that is easy to use can save you time and reduce the risk of errors. Look for features like clear instructions, intuitive controls, and easy die changes. Some tools also offer automatic crimping functions, which can further simplify the process. If you're new to crimping or need to train others to use the tool, prioritize ease of use. For experienced users, advanced features might be more important.
DurabilityDurability refers to the tool's ability to withstand regular use and harsh conditions. A durable crimping tool will last longer and provide more reliable performance. Look for tools made from high-quality materials like steel or aluminum, and check for features like corrosion resistance. Durability is especially important if you plan to use the tool frequently or in demanding environments. Consider the conditions in which you'll be using the tool and choose one that can handle those conditions without frequent repairs or replacements.
